Safeguarding the Tongue

The Imam of the Pious, the Beloved Messenger of Allah (peace and blessings be upon him), said,

“Whoever guarantees me that they’ll safeguard what is between their lips and what is between their legs, I guarantee Paradise for them.” [Related by Ahmad, #22315]

Times Online - What Homeschooling Taught Me - Comment

Some people confuse means and ends. Homeschooling is a means. The end is true learning and meaningful education. Not everyone can homeschool; and learning and education can take place through a myriad of means.

The sunna is to take the best and most effective of means in each situation.
